Skin Ulcers: Pharmacotherapy.

FP essentials, 2020
Topical wound therapies have unclear benefits for patients with pressure ulcers, venous leg ulcers (VLUs), and arterial ulcers. There is slightly more evidence supporting the use of systemic therapies. Used with compression therapy or alone, oral pentoxifylline has been shown to be more effective than placebo or no therapy in improving and healing VLUs.

Erosive and Ulcerative Skin Disease

Veterinary Clinics of North America: Small Animal Practice, 1995
Many causes exist for ulcerative disease of the skin and mucous membranes of cats. History, physical examination, cytology, skin biopsy, a hemogram, serum biochemical evaluation, and FeLV and feline immunodeficiency virus testing are a standard diagnostic protocol for such cases. Therapy is dependent on the underlying cause.

Managing ischemic skin ulcers.

American family physician, 1975
Etiologic elements in ischemic ulcers include physical factors (pressure, shearing forces, friction and heat), nutrition and infection, as well as circulatory, metabolic and neurologic problems. Prevention is the primary objective of the management program.
